Output 5429231e5115f7f72061590c70ab684ddb2f86a4287bfbeb5719ed5fce5c6821:0

value
2660286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2dcba7953b30537f5537813003f26c10d992c4 OP_EQUAL
address
MTt55NQqCyk8NtTba7cENcVdDU12of1tEF
transaction
5429231e5115f7f72061590c70ab684ddb2f86a4287bfbeb5719ed5fce5c6821
spent
true